新技術(shù)浪潮下的產(chǎn)業(yè)變革,使各種技術(shù)不斷出現(xiàn)、消失或被沿用,多年來底層技術(shù)平臺的發(fā)展,為互聯(lián)網(wǎng)產(chǎn)品提供了重要驅(qū)動力,而在互聯(lián)網(wǎng)下半場,技術(shù)能力正在從C端市場轉(zhuǎn)向B端,對業(yè)務(wù)及IT架構(gòu)的賦能將決定著一家企業(yè)的核心競爭力。
長久以來,面對種類繁多的技術(shù)選型,我們很難透過輿論和簡單的體驗(yàn)來判斷哪些技術(shù)趨勢更值得選擇,但若在有效應(yīng)用后逆向倒推,往往更容易發(fā)現(xiàn)他們的價值所在。
低代碼正是這樣一個逐漸被廣泛應(yīng)用的技術(shù)趨勢,在與敏捷開發(fā)相得益彰的同時,以其更加有序、安全、高效及可維護(hù)的方式出現(xiàn)在更多企業(yè)的IT架構(gòu)當(dāng)中。
要想在低代碼平臺上取得成功,使用者、決策者通常要充分了解數(shù)據(jù)架構(gòu)和邏輯流程——
事實(shí)上,企業(yè)的所有應(yīng)用最終都可能要進(jìn)行數(shù)據(jù)打通,甚至構(gòu)建數(shù)據(jù)中臺,即使是個別小型、獨(dú)立的應(yīng)用程序,最終也需要通過企業(yè)主數(shù)據(jù)進(jìn)行驗(yàn)證或通信,并向下游系統(tǒng)提供手動輸入的數(shù)據(jù)。
那么基于低代碼開發(fā)平臺,若要生產(chǎn)系統(tǒng)、數(shù)據(jù)倉庫以及其他內(nèi)部系統(tǒng)步調(diào)一致,就要預(yù)先制定數(shù)據(jù)存儲和移動策略;此外,為保障數(shù)據(jù)安全、防止漏洞或數(shù)據(jù)丟失,還應(yīng)制定安全計(jì)劃和體系結(jié)構(gòu),在部署低代碼開發(fā)平臺前,企業(yè)CIO、CTO等決策者應(yīng)提前考慮與規(guī)劃。
很多低代碼平臺都具備較強(qiáng)的BPM(業(yè)務(wù)流程管理即Business Process Management)背景,而能夠熟練使用流程軟件的團(tuán)隊(duì)通常在低代碼平臺中也會更加得心應(yīng)手;在企業(yè)創(chuàng)建內(nèi)部應(yīng)用的過程中,邏輯流程對于業(yè)務(wù)、員工、審批等管理環(huán)節(jié)的重要性不言而喻,低代碼通過盡量簡化的方式實(shí)現(xiàn)這一邏輯,并被廣泛應(yīng)用;正所謂“好船配好帆”,搭建低代碼開發(fā)平臺時,應(yīng)注重組織內(nèi)流程信息的梳理,并加強(qiáng)平臺使用者的邏輯思維能力。
低代碼開發(fā)平臺雖以高效見長,但實(shí)際應(yīng)用的優(yōu)勢比我們想象更豐富——
大型企業(yè)的IT部門都存在大量的積壓需求,低代碼的出現(xiàn)為負(fù)擔(dān)過重的IT技術(shù)人員提供了一個高效的生產(chǎn)力工具,在與業(yè)務(wù)部門快速協(xié)同中,有效緩解需求積壓的現(xiàn)象;此外,有些IT組織也在培訓(xùn)業(yè)務(wù)部門來使用低代碼平臺,此舉可有效地?cái)U(kuò)展公司的應(yīng)用程序開發(fā)人員庫!
很多公司的重要數(shù)據(jù)通常以電子表格形式進(jìn)行存儲,提供決策參考時,表格中的數(shù)據(jù)還要進(jìn)行二次合并與分析,此過程中,數(shù)據(jù)的規(guī)范性、同步性、錯誤率都難以保障,就算選擇了SaaS產(chǎn)品,但對于很多定制化的需求和數(shù)據(jù)仍難以實(shí)現(xiàn),最終還將轉(zhuǎn)化為電子表格再進(jìn)行二次加工;但若將這些數(shù)據(jù)移動到低代碼平臺,數(shù)據(jù)可放置在備份、安全、審計(jì)的安全環(huán)境中,在提升數(shù)據(jù)分析能力的同時確保企業(yè)數(shù)據(jù)實(shí)時性。
互聯(lián)網(wǎng)時代數(shù)據(jù)是最寶貴的無形財(cái)產(chǎn),但它們通常被鎖定,難以使用且更換成本高昂;通常IT部門需要將數(shù)據(jù)同步給一線員工,企業(yè)的效率越高,數(shù)據(jù)驅(qū)動程度也越高。低代碼平臺可提供一套保障性解決方案,將數(shù)據(jù)安全地連接至系統(tǒng)并交付給業(yè)務(wù)人員,而對于數(shù)據(jù)分析與自定義流程的擴(kuò)展也提供了足夠靈活的開放性。
大型企業(yè),各種產(chǎn)品線與業(yè)務(wù)流程或多達(dá)上百種,運(yùn)營過程中,若有多個工作流需要實(shí)現(xiàn)數(shù)字化,那么通過低代碼平臺來實(shí)現(xiàn)可大幅降低IT部署成本;這些不斷變化的流程若采購可能需要多個SaaS服務(wù)支持,而使用低代碼開發(fā)平臺,內(nèi)部快速開發(fā)的時間成本、維護(hù)成本與靈活性更為顯著。
低代碼平臺非常適合讓業(yè)務(wù)更深入地融入敏捷開發(fā),由于支持應(yīng)用程序快速開發(fā),IT人員可與業(yè)務(wù)人員同步協(xié)作創(chuàng)建原型,節(jié)省需求和設(shè)計(jì)階段的時間,提升業(yè)務(wù)需求的精準(zhǔn)度。
現(xiàn)如今,越來越多的企業(yè)正在擺脫過時的應(yīng)用系統(tǒng),面對互聯(lián)網(wǎng)產(chǎn)品與數(shù)字化營銷需求,如何建設(shè)企業(yè)IT架構(gòu)有很多種選擇,但其核心都指向敏捷開發(fā),低代碼在國外的應(yīng)用程度遠(yuǎn)高于國內(nèi),而其所形成的技術(shù)趨勢正在快速向我們蔓延。